Tottenham Hotspur responds as Manchester United prepare club record bid for Harry Kane

Premier League rivals Tottenham Hotspur do not intend selling Harry Kane this summer to Manchester United, according to The Athletic via Metro.
Manchester United have made Kane a top transfer target ahead of the summer transfer window and are willing to offer a club record fee for the transfer of the 29 year old striker. United’s club transfer record is the £89million spent to sign Paul Pogba from Juventus in 2016.
Tottenham Hotspur are reportedly not contemplating selling Kane this summer and instead are aiming to extend Kane’s contract which expires next year.
The report claims that initial talks have been held with Kane and Spurs are willing to let the England captain enter the final year of his contract while negotiations continue.
